Carrying Out Thorough Instance Investigations



To effectively represent your clients, conduct an extensive examination of the instance. This is crucial in constructing a strong protection method and uncovering any kind of evidence that can sustain your client's innocence or minimize their charges.

Beginning by evaluating all available records, such as police records, witness declarations, and forensic records. Meeting witnesses, both the prosecution's and your very own, to gather added details or identify disparities.

See the crime scene to obtain a much better understanding of the conditions surrounding the situation. Speak with experts, such as forensic professionals or private investigators, to aid in analyzing proof or situating prospective witnesses.

In addition, discover any prospective legal problems or constitutional infractions that could influence the instance. By conducting a detailed investigation, you can reveal essential information and develop a compelling protection method that provides your customer the very best chance at a desirable result.

Navigating the Obstacles of Interrogation



When cross-examining witnesses, you must be prepared to face numerous obstacles and successfully navigate them to enhance your case. Cross-examination can be a critical moment in a test, as it enables you to challenge the reliability and reliability of the witness's testimony.

One challenge you might experience is a hostile witness who's uncooperative or combative. In such a circumstance, it's important to maintain your calmness and stay concentrated on the realities.

Another difficulty is managing incredibly elusive witnesses that try to prevent addressing your inquiries straight. To conquer this, you can rephrase your concerns or existing contradictory proof to collar the witness.

Furthermore, you may face objections from the rival guidance during cross-examination. It's vital to prepare for possible objections and be prepared with influential arguments to counter them.

Leveraging Technology in the Court room



Throughout your protection, you can properly take advantage of innovation in the court room to present proof and engage the jury. Modern technology has actually become an important part of the legal process, offering attorneys with innovative tools to reinforce their case. By integrating innovation right into your defense method, you can enhance your presentation and boost your chances of success.

Here are three means to leverage innovation in the courtroom:

- Usage multimedia discussions: Providing evidence with video clips, photos, and audio recordings can help you convey intricate information in an extra engaging and understandable fashion.

- Make use of courtroom presentation software: Software programs like TrialDirector or PowerPoint can assist you in arranging and offering your instance efficiently, allowing you to highlight bottom lines and visually involve the court.

- Gain access to electronic databases and research devices: On-line lawful research databases and various other technical sources can give you with quick accessibility to appropriate case law, laws, and legal criteria, enabling you to strengthen your arguments and counter opposing claims.
